Transaction 68e9527e99be2315de1a70851f2c332a3651e348ddd431f35ce346bbe805b95a
1 Input
1 Output
-
68e9527e99be2315de1a70851f2c332a3651e348ddd431f35ce346bbe805b95a:0
- value
- 561707
- script pubkey
- OP_0 OP_PUSHBYTES_20 70e160a44ec645edd7c9aa76d6149e2255a49699
- address
- bc1qwrskpfzwcez7m47f4fmdv9y7yf26f95epugvnq